impl<E: Environment, I: IntegerType> DivChecked<Self> for Integer<E, I> {
type Output = Self;
#[inline]
fn div_checked(&self, other: &Integer<E, I>) -> Self::Output {
match (self.is_constant(), other.is_constant()) {
(_, true) if other.eject_value().is_zero() => E::halt("Attempted to divide by zero."),
(true, true) => match self.eject_value().checked_div(&other.eject_value()) {
Some(value) => Integer::constant(console::Integer::new(value)),
None => E::halt("Overflow on division of two integer constants"),
},
_ => {
if I::is_signed() {
let min = Integer::constant(console::Integer::MIN);
let neg_one = Integer::constant(-console::Integer::one());
let overflows = self.is_equal(&min) & other.is_equal(&neg_one);
E::assert(!overflows);
let unsigned_dividend = self.abs_wrapped().cast_as_dual();
let unsigned_divisor = other.abs_wrapped().cast_as_dual();
let unsigned_quotient = unsigned_dividend.div_wrapped(&unsigned_divisor);
let signed_quotient = Integer { bits_le: unsigned_quotient.bits_le, phantom: Default::default() };
let operands_same_sign = &self.msb().is_equal(other.msb());
Self::ternary(operands_same_sign, &signed_quotient, &Self::zero().sub_wrapped(&signed_quotient))
} else {
self.div_wrapped(other)
}
}
}
}
}
